Tag: bash

Sledovač pre spúšťanie Dusk testov

Po úspešnom skúsenosti s mojím sledovacím skriptom pre unit a feature testy som sa rozhodol postaviť niečo podobné aj pre Laravel Dusk E2E (end-to-end) testy. Po mnohých iteráciách som však zistil, že tentokrát to bude trochu iné. Začal som jednoducho aktualizáciou sledovača pre...

Automatický zálohovací skript pre Remarkable na Macu

Automatická záloha Remarkable2 na Macu Tento skript zálohuje dáta a konfiguráciu z vášho tabletu Remarkable2 do repozitára vždy, keď je pripojený cez USB, commitne zmeny a pushne na origin. Inštalácia Vytvorte git repozitár s originom a s týmto skriptom: ``bash #!/bin/bash BACKUP...

Ukladanie zálohy Mikrotiku do repozitára

Zatiaľ nie som pokročilým používateľom zariadení Mikrotik, čo dokazuje fakt, že terminál tam nepoužívam tak veľa ako webové rozhranie (alebo WebFig, ako ho nazývajú). Ale Mikrotik, ako výkonná platforma, mi môže pomôcť pochopiť, čo robím. Jedna z vecí, na ktorú som nedávno prišie...

PHP test watcher pre MacOS

Môj predchádzajúci Laravel test watcher som úspešne používal veľmi dlho, keď som bol na Linuxe. Teraz na Macu však nefunguje, pretože Mac nepodporuje inotifywait. Mac však podporuje niečo podobné, čo sa nazýva fswatch, nainštalovateľné cez Brew: ``bash brew install fswatch ` Fung...

Oprava ANSI dát v nvim execute

Po migrácii mojich dotfiles na Mac M3 som narazil na blokujúci problém v mojom neovim nastavení. Zakaždým, keď som uložil PHP súbor, na jeho začiatok sa pridalo veľa nezmyselných dát. Ak si pamätáte, moje nastavenie používa prettier na formátovanie všetkého, väčšinou cez coc-pret...

Post-checkout hook pre composer install

Niekedy pri práci na PHP projekte, kde existuje veľa vetiev potenciálne s nekompatibilnými balíkmi, môže byť otravné stále pamätať na manuálne spúšťanie composer i alebo akejkoľvek docker alternatívy či aliasu. Po zabudnutí sa objavujú chybové hlásenia, ktoré zanášajú logy, a kaž...

Optimalizácia viacerých PDF naraz

Musel som pracovať s množstvom naskenovaných PDF dokumentov, ktoré boli uložené veľmi neoptimálnym spôsobom — každý mal až desiatky MB. Toto nebolo vhodné na odosielanie e-mailom a bolo to zbytočné. Na Macu mojej priateľky som videl možnosť optimalizovať PDF. Výsledok bol, že jej...